Fabric & Material Breakdown in a Modern Police Officer Uniform Description
The foundation of any police officer uniform description lies in its materials. Most modern uniforms use high-performance fabrics such as:
- Polyester-Cotton Blends: Offer durability, resistance to shrinking, and quick-drying properties—ideal for daily wear.
- Flame-Retardant (FR) Fabrics: Essential for officers working in hazardous environments or near fire incidents.
- Metallic/Reflective Threads: Integrated into jackets and vests to increase visibility during low-light operations.
- Moisture-Wicking Linings: Help regulate body temperature, especially during physical pursuits or summer patrols.

Functional Elements in a Police Officer Uniform Description
Functionality defines the true value of a police officer uniform description. Key features include:
- Multiple Pockets: Strategically placed for carrying radios, pens, notebooks, and other essential tools.
- Adjustable Waistbands & Reinforced Seams: Allow for comfort and longevity under pressure.
- Modular Vest Integration: Enables attachment of ballistic protection, first aid kits, and equipment without compromising mobility.
- Breathable Panels: Found in jackets and shirts to prevent overheating during prolonged duty hours.

Departmental Identity Through Uniform Design
One of the most powerful aspects of a police officer uniform description is its ability to convey identity. Colors, insignias, patches, and even the cut of the uniform communicate belonging and hierarchy. For example:
- Blue and black are common for general patrol units.
- Green or tan tones may be used by rural or specialized units.
- Rank badges and shoulder boards denote leadership roles.
- Department mottos or city seals add a layer of civic pride.
